Rock Paper Scissors in Java 8 with Streams

package java8tests; | |
import java.util.Iterator; | |
import java.util.Random; | |
import java.util.stream.Stream; | |
public class RockPaperScissors { | |
enum Result { | |
WIN, LOSE, DRAW | |
} | |
enum Move { | |
ROCK, PAPER, SCISSORS ; | |
static { | |
ROCK.beats = SCISSORS ; | |
PAPER.beats = ROCK ; | |
SCISSORS.beats = PAPER ; | |
} | |
private Move beats ; | |
public boolean beats( Move other ) { | |
return beats == other ; | |
} | |
} | |
class PlayerMove { | |
private final String player ; | |
private final Move move ; | |
public PlayerMove( String player, Move move ) { | |
this.player = player ; | |
this.move = move ; | |
} | |
@Override | |
public String toString() { | |
return String.format( "%s:%s", getPlayer(), getMove()) ; | |
} | |
public String getPlayer() { | |
return player; | |
} | |
public Move getMove() { | |
return move; | |
} | |
} | |
class Turn { | |
private final PlayerMove p1 ; | |
private final PlayerMove p2 ; | |
public Turn( PlayerMove p1, PlayerMove p2 ) { | |
this.p1 = p1 ; | |
this.p2 = p2 ; | |
} | |
@Override | |
public String toString() { | |
return String.format( "%s vs %s", getP1(), getP2()) ; | |
} | |
public PlayerMove getP1() { | |
return p1; | |
} | |
public PlayerMove getP2() { | |
return p2; | |
} | |
} | |
private final Random rnd = new Random() ; | |
Stream<Move> moves() { | |
return Stream.generate( () -> Move.values()[ rnd.nextInt( Move.values().length ) ] ) ; | |
} | |
Stream<PlayerMove> player( String name ) { | |
return moves().map( ( m ) -> new PlayerMove( name, m ) ) ; | |
} | |
Stream<Turn> turn( String player1, String player2 ) { | |
// No zip for Streams :-( | |
Iterator<PlayerMove> p1 = player( player1 ).iterator() ; | |
Iterator<PlayerMove> p2 = player( player2 ).iterator() ; | |
return Stream.generate( () -> new Turn( p1.next(), p2.next() ) ) ; | |
} | |
Result result( Turn t ) { | |
return t.getP1().getMove() == t.getP2().getMove() ? Result.DRAW : | |
t.getP1().getMove().beats( t.getP2().getMove()) ? Result.WIN : | |
Result.LOSE ; | |
} | |
String resultMessage( Turn t, Result r ) { | |
return r == Result.DRAW ? "DRAW" : | |
r == Result.WIN ? String.format( "%s wins", t.getP1().getPlayer()) : | |
String.format( "%s wins", t.getP2().getPlayer()) ; | |
} | |
String message( Turn t ) { | |
return String.format( "%s : %s", t.toString(), resultMessage( t, result( t ) ) ) ; | |
} | |
Stream<String> game( String player1, String player2, int turns ) { | |
return turn( player1, player2 ).limit( turns ) | |
.map( (t) -> message( t ) ) ; | |
} | |
public static void main( String[] args ) { | |
new RockPaperScissors().game( "tim", "alice", 5 ) | |
.forEach( (m) -> System.out.println( m ) ) ; | |
} | |
} |

// By popular demand ;-) | |
package java8tests; | |
import java.util.Arrays; | |
import java.util.HashSet; | |
import java.util.Iterator; | |
import java.util.Random; | |
import java.util.Set; | |
import java.util.stream.Stream; | |
public class RockPaperScissorsLizardSpock { | |
enum Result { | |
WIN, LOSE, DRAW | |
} | |
enum Move { | |
ROCK, PAPER, SCISSORS, LIZARD, SPOCK ; | |
static { | |
ROCK.beats = new HashSet<>( Arrays.asList( LIZARD, SCISSORS ) ) ; | |
PAPER.beats = new HashSet<>( Arrays.asList( ROCK, SPOCK ) ) ; | |
SCISSORS.beats = new HashSet<>( Arrays.asList( PAPER, LIZARD ) ) ; | |
LIZARD.beats = new HashSet<>( Arrays.asList( SPOCK, PAPER ) ) ; | |
SPOCK.beats = new HashSet<>( Arrays.asList( SCISSORS, ROCK ) ) ; | |
} | |
private Set<Move> beats ; | |
public boolean beats( Move other ) { | |
return beats.contains( other ) ; | |
} | |
} | |
class PlayerMove { | |
private final String player ; | |
private final Move move ; | |
public PlayerMove( String player, Move move ) { | |
this.player = player ; | |
this.move = move ; | |
} | |
@Override | |
public String toString() { | |
return String.format( "%s:%s", getPlayer(), getMove()) ; | |
} | |
public String getPlayer() { | |
return player; | |
} | |
public Move getMove() { | |
return move; | |
} | |
} | |
class Turn { | |
private final PlayerMove p1 ; | |
private final PlayerMove p2 ; | |
public Turn( PlayerMove p1, PlayerMove p2 ) { | |
this.p1 = p1 ; | |
this.p2 = p2 ; | |
} | |
@Override | |
public String toString() { | |
return String.format( "%s vs %s", getP1(), getP2()) ; | |
} | |
public PlayerMove getP1() { | |
return p1; | |
} | |
public PlayerMove getP2() { | |
return p2; | |
} | |
} | |
private final Random rnd = new Random() ; | |
Stream<Move> moves() { | |
return Stream.generate( () -> Move.values()[ rnd.nextInt( Move.values().length ) ] ) ; | |
} | |
Stream<PlayerMove> player( String name ) { | |
return moves().map( ( m ) -> new PlayerMove( name, m ) ) ; | |
} | |
Stream<Turn> turn( String player1, String player2 ) { | |
// No zip for Streams :-( | |
Iterator<PlayerMove> p1 = player( player1 ).iterator() ; | |
Iterator<PlayerMove> p2 = player( player2 ).iterator() ; | |
return Stream.generate( () -> new Turn( p1.next(), p2.next() ) ) ; | |
} | |
Result result( Turn t ) { | |
return t.getP1().getMove() == t.getP2().getMove() ? Result.DRAW : | |
t.getP1().getMove().beats( t.getP2().getMove()) ? Result.WIN : | |
Result.LOSE ; | |
} | |
String resultMessage( Turn t, Result r ) { | |
return r == Result.DRAW ? "DRAW" : | |
r == Result.WIN ? String.format( "%s wins", t.getP1().getPlayer()) : | |
String.format( "%s wins", t.getP2().getPlayer()) ; | |
} | |
String message( Turn t ) { | |
return String.format( "%s : %s", t.toString(), resultMessage( t, result( t ) ) ) ; | |
} | |
Stream<String> game( String player1, String player2, int turns ) { | |
return turn( player1, player2 ).limit( turns ) | |
.map( (t) -> message( t ) ) ; | |
} | |
public static void main( String[] args ) { | |
new RockPaperScissorsLizardSpock().game( "tim", "alice", 5 ) | |
.forEach( (m) -> System.out.println( m ) ) ; | |
} | |
} |
